Hydrocyclone systems are integral in keeping unwanted particles such as sand, glass, metal, plastic, and Styrofoam from pulp. Unfortunately, Recycled Fiber Mills and those operating over capacity have harsh conditions for pulp cleaning systems, that often result in fiber losses and plugging. By leveraging new technology built from proven hydrocyclone designs, mills can improve runnability, reduce fiber losses, and lower operational costs.
